其实c语言单精度怎么表示?深入解析其格式的问题并不复杂,但是又很多的朋友都不太了解c语言单精度输出,因此呢,今天小编就来为大家分享c语言单精度怎么表示?深入解析其格式的一些知识,希望可以帮助到大家,下面我们一起来看看这个问题的分析吧!
文章目录:
- 1、C语言编程:怎么让编写的程序理解用户给出的函数解析式,并绘制出相应的...
- 2、c语言中四舍五入怎么表示
- 3、解说float取值范围计算过程
- 4、c语言小数怎么表示
- 5、C语言怎么表示单精度浮点数
- 6、C语言进阶之路:数据类型-整型(int)、字符(char)、浮点(float、double...
C语言编程:怎么让编写的程序理解用户给出的函数解析式,并绘制出相应的...
1、将你的需求分成两部分,一是让程序自行解析用户输入的函数解析式,二是绘制函数图像。
2、这题就是定义一个独立函数,参数为n和x,根据n的值,断并选择多项式中的一个式子来计算y的值。计算结果和x的值可直接在函数中打印,也可放数组做返回值返回,在主函数中接收并打印输出。
3、打开桌面上的DEV_C++,如下界面:快捷键“CTRL+N”建立新源代码。
4、if(x的第一个取值范围)y=相应关于x的函数;el if(x的第二个取值范围)y=相应关于x的函数;el if(x的第三个取值范围)y=相应关于x的函数;printf(%d,y);} 图自己画,简单。
5、以下是一个简单的C语言程序,可以比较两个整数x和y,并打印出相应的结果:在这个程序中,我们首先声明了两个整数变量x和y,然后使用printf函数提示用户输入两个整数。接下来,我们使用scanf函数读取用户输入的整数,并将它们存储在变量x和y中。然后,我们使用一个if-el语句来比较x和y的值。
c语言中四舍五入怎么表示
1、要用C语言实现四舍五入,有一个很巧妙的方法,仅使用int i=(int)(a+0.5)即可。如果遇到有负数的情况,只需要将加号改为减号即可。C语言中四舍五入这样表示:inta=100.453627。printf(%.1f,a+0.05);//四舍五入到十分位。printf(%.2f,a+0.005);//四舍五入到百分位。
2、C语言里面,四舍五入的原理就是满5进1。用代码实现就是加上0.5,再截去小数。对于浮点数。float x = 456; //保留到小数点后两位 float y =(int)(a * 100) + 0.5) / 100.0;//output b = 46;对于整数。
3、没能正确地做四舍五入是因为有效数字个数超出 double 允许范围,尾部数据不精确了。有效数字少一点时,我的编译器(VC++ 0) 好像能做四舍五入。
4、四舍五入”,只要通过输出格式符控制即可。例如:double pi=1415926;printf(%.4lf\n,pi);可得输出为1416。printf(%.2lf\n,pi);可得输出为14。
5、当多种不同运算组成一个运算表达式。学习C语言的方法 可以先看一些关于C语言的书籍,对C语言有一些了解,可以为自己以后的学习有帮助,知道C语言编程的基本知识,学习C语言主要考验的是逻辑思维和坚持学习的恒心,学习编程特别是语言类的知识,需要多看书多思考多练习。
6、首先打开DEV C++,点击“新建源代码”,在编辑页面输入以下代码。因为题目要求我们先输入一个整数,所以在定义变量时,就应该将其定义为整数型,注意,在输入,输出函数中,整数型对应的是“%d”。接下来就要对输入的整数进行断,在C语言中,if是断语句,所以用它来对整数进行断。
解说float取值范围计算过程
实型变量的存储格式与取值范围C语言中的实型变量,无论是float、double还是long double,都采用IEEE 754标准进行存储。这些类型的变量在内存中以指数形式表示,包括符号位、指数和尾数。具体来说:Sign(1位):指示浮点数的正负,0为正,1为负。
对于float的最大取值范围,当指数位最大(即11111111减1)且尾数全为1时,可得到范围。具体来说,指数为255(二进制11111111),尾数最大为1的23次方。因此,float的取值范围大约在17549e-38到40282e+38之间,不包括这两个极端值。
float的取值范围是-402823466×10的38次方到402823466×10的38次方。float(单精度浮点数)虽然是用4字节32位存储,但它各数间距并不固定,所以叫浮点型。简单讲就是离0越远精度越低。
c语言小数怎么表示
c语言小数有两种表示方式:定点表示:必须有小数点。例如:0.123, .123, 120。指数表示:e或E之前必须有数字,指数必须为整数。例如:13e3 ,123E2, 23e4。
两种表示方式:定点表示:必须有小数点。例如:0.123, .123, 120。指数表示:e或E之前必须有数字,指数必须为整数。例如:13e3 ,123E2, 23e4。注意:浮点数常量默认为double类型,如果浮点数常量表示float类型,在末尾添加小写的f或者大写的F,表示此常量为单精度浮点常量。
小数点前面的数字表示输出列数,数字位数大于它时,按实际位数输出,小数点前空缺也是。小数点后面的数字表示输出的小数点位数,如果位数不足就会四舍五入,如果位数不够显示就会在后面补0。
C语言怎么表示单精度浮点数
1、在C语言源码中,只能在浮点数后面加f来表示单精度浮点数。例如:float f=0f\x0d\x0a单精度浮点数(Single)\x0d\x0a用来表示带有小数部分的实数,一般用于科学计算。\x0d\x0a占用4个字节(32位)存储空间,包括符号位1位,阶码8位,尾数23位。
2、在C语言源码中,只能在浮点数后面加f来表示单精度浮点数。譬如如下代码:float f = 1f; 或者float f = 1F;大小写都可以的。
3、在C语言中,浮点数类型包括单精度浮点数和双精度浮点数。单精度浮点数使用float类型表示,而双精度浮点数使用double类型表示。使用f作为前缀,可以使编译器知道变量是一个浮点数类型,从而可以正确地处理浮点数运算。
4、float类型的字面常量,后面需要加上f或者F来表示是一个单精度浮点数。只所以要这样写,是因为默认的浮点数常量都是double类型。
5、float是C语言中的一个数据类型的关键字,表示单精度浮点型(双精度浮点型为double)。定义格式为:float a; // a表示一个浮点型的变量。C语言规定浮点型在内存占用4个字节,精度为7位,取值范围为:4*10^-38 ~4*10^38或者-(4*10^-38 ~4*10^38)。
6、f表示单精度浮点数float,6表示数据表示至少6位,后面的.2表示小数点后保留两位 比如23212365用这个表示的话,结果就是23212 如果不足六位就会在前面补空格 超过六位的话正常显示 代码例子:int main(){ float a=6261234;printf(%2f,a);return 0;} 结果就是62612。
C语言进阶之路:数据类型-整型(int)、字符(char)、浮点(float、double...
1、深入解析C语言数据类型:整型(int)、字符(char)、浮点型(float、double)在C语言的领域中,数据类型是构成代码的基本元素。其中,基本类型包含了整型、字符、浮点型(单精度、双精度)以及枚举类型。构造类型则包括数组、结构体和共用体。整型(int)数据类型在不同中大小有所不同,一般为32位或64位。
2、基本数据类型 在C语言中,基本数据类型是指内置的数据类型,它们在程序中直接使用,不需要用户自定义。这些数据类型包括整型(int)、字符型(char)、浮点型(float)和双精度浮点型(double)。 整型(int):用于存储整数,可以是正数、负数或零。例如,int a = 10; 表示变量a的值为10。
3、C语言的基本数据类型包括:整型(int)、浮点型(float和double)、字符型(char)、布尔型(bool)以及派生类型如指针类型。基本数据类型介绍 整型(int):用于表示整数。在计算机中,整数可以是有符号的,也可以是无符号的。有符号整数表示可以表示正数和负数,无符号整数只能表示正数。
4、c语言基本数据类型包括整型(int)、短整型(short)、长整型(long)、无符号整型(unsigned)、浮点型(float)、双精度浮点型(double)、字符型(char)、布尔型(bool)。整型(int)用于表示整数值,其大小根据不同的编译器和平台有所差异,通常在32位下为4字节,64位下为8字节。
5、浮点型利用指数使小数点的位置可以根据需要而上下浮动,从而可以灵活地表达更大范围的实数。双精度浮点型,此数据类型与单精度数据类型(float)相似,但精确度比float高,编译时所占的内存空间依不同的编译器而有所不同,是double float数据类型,C/C++中表示实型变量的一种变量类型。
好了,文章到这里就结束啦,如果本次分享的c语言单精度怎么表示?深入解析其格式和c语言单精度输出问题对您有所帮助,还望关注下本站哦!